Strong's:σημειόω to distinguish, i.e. mark (for avoidance)Derivation: from G4592;KJV Usage: note. G4592
TBESG:σημειόωto noteG:V σημειόω, -ῶ (< σημεῖον), [in LXX: Psa.4:6 (נָשָׂא)* ;] to mark, note. Mid., to note for oneself: 2Th.3:14 (freq. in π.; see ICC, M, Th., in l).† (AS)
σημειόω sēmeioō say-mi-o'-o From G4592; to distinguish, that is, mark (for avoidance)KJV Usage: note.
σημεῖον sēmeion say-mi'-on Neuter of a presumed derivative of the base of G4591; an indication, especially ceremonially or supernaturallyKJV Usage: miracle, sign, token, wonder.
